Output ec668a0413001957f1fe73168234c853e3c9cdc966b9090eeb2b9b240f0e4a44:1

value
2615460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d2a05c142f5d1e12efc8bf6d42da34d1ab6edb OP_EQUAL
address
3G5WLEtfH7N7LzK83khfr9N5nNmxEf7jq9
transaction
ec668a0413001957f1fe73168234c853e3c9cdc966b9090eeb2b9b240f0e4a44
spent
true